nbd: stop using the bdev everywhere
Browse files Browse the repository at this point in the history
In preparation for the upcoming netlink interface we need to not rely on
already having the bdev for the NBD device we are doing operations on.
Instead of passing the bdev around, just use it in places where we know
we already have the bdev.
